Background on AI Content Marking Challenges
Marking AI-generated text has long been a challenge due to the ease of paraphrasing, editing, or translating language, which can weaken embedded signals. Previous approaches have included metadata, statistical patterns, or embedded characters, but none have achieved universal adoption or robustness. Recent efforts by AI developers like Anthropic to introduce watermarking aim to address these issues, but technical specifics and deployment status remain unconfirmed. The idea of AI watermarking gained attention as part of broader conversations on AI transparency and responsible deployment, especially with the rise of large language models like Claude.

Next Steps for Verification and Transparency
The next critical step is for Anthropic or independent researchers to publish detailed technical documentation and conduct reproducible tests. These tests should evaluate the watermark’s robustness against editing, paraphrasing, and translation, as well as its false positive and false negative rates. Publishers and search engines will likely await such evidence before integrating watermark detection into workflows. Continued monitoring of Anthropic’s updates and third-party evaluations will clarify the system’s actual deployment and effectiveness.
